CALL FOR ARTWORK FOR THE ART EXHIBITION AT THE 13th AOEC

We are delighted to announce a call for artwork for the Art Exhibition at the 13th Asian & Oceanian Epilepsy Congress (AOEC).

The call is open to everyone at any age, including people with epilepsy and their carers, doctors, nurses, social workers, etc.

All entries will be included in the online Art Exhibition as a PDF gallery featured as part of the virtual 13th AOEC. The most impressive 3 artworks will be selected and introduced at the IBE Epilepsy & Society Symposium taking place virtually on Sunday, 13 June 2021 as a part of the 13th AOEC.

Entry rules

Artwork acceptable for the exhibition are the following:

o Painting or drawing

o Photomontage

o Pottery

o Sculpture

o Beadwork, embroidery or needlework

  • A contestant may submit no more than 3 pieces of art.
  • Submission should be by way of a scan or photo of the artwork. Scans or photos should within 1MB – 3MB or should be spread over multiple emails.
  • The quality of scans or photos is the responsibility of the art exhibition entrant.
  • Each entry must be the original work of the contestant, must have a title (in English) and also include a short description of the idea and meaning of the artwork (recommended a maximum of 200 words).
  • By submitting an entry to the art exhibition, the contestant agrees to grant IBE, free of charge, the right to publish the piece of art online, in other IBE media, or as part of an exhibition.
  • All entries should be sent to 13554357579@163.com before the closing date of 21st May 2021. No late entries will be accepted.
  • An independent judging panel will select 3 outstanding pieces of artwork and the artists of these pieces will be invited to make a short presentation via zoom as part of IBE’s Epilepsy & Society Symposium on the afternoon of the 13 June 2021. If you do not wish to be considered for the oral presentation, please indicate this when submitting your piece of art.
